Overview
We are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Speech Language Pathologist to join our team. In this role, you will work primarily with home health patients, providing essential speech therapy services to help them overcome communication and swallowing disorders. Your expertise in patient assessment, medical terminology, and anatomy will be crucial in developing effective treatment plans tailored to each child's unique needs. The ideal candidate will have experience in a school setting and a strong understanding of early intervention strategies.
Responsibilities
- Conduct comprehensive assessments to evaluate speech and language abilities in pediatric patients.
- Develop individualized treatment plans based on assessment results and patient needs.
- Implement evidence-based speech therapy techniques to improve communication skills.
- Collaborate with patients, patient families, care team members, and other healthcare professionals to support the patient's development.
- Monitor patient progress and adjust treatment plans as necessary to ensure optimal outcomes.
- Educate patients, families and caregivers on strategies to reinforce speech therapy goals at home.
- Maintain accurate documentation of patient assessments, treatment plans, and progress notes.
Requirements
- Master's degree in Speech Language Pathology from an accredited program.
- Valid state licensure or certification as a Speech Language Pathologist.
- Experience working with home health populations.
- Strong knowledge of physiology, anatomy, and medical terminology related to speech therapy.
- Familiarity with home health practices and patient care techniques.
- Excellent communication skills and the ability to work collaboratively with diverse teams.
Compassionate demeanor with a genuine passion for helping children achieve their communication goals. Join us in making a difference in the lives of children through effective speech therapy interventions
